An overwhelming favourite, the Spiny Leaf Insect is a hardy pet, easy to keep and a fascinating addition to your home or school.

Adult female 150mm (sold as juveniles ~30mm in body length)

  • Also known as Macleay's Spectre after their distinctive camouflage.
  • Suitable for all ages and experience levels. Great to handle!
  • Feeds on Eucalyptus leaves and much more.
  • Captive bred through our environmentally sustainable breeding program.

    Spiny leaf insects are a wonderful pet for any age. They are especially popular with the preschool children I teach. They are a wonderful introduction to insects/entomology and are surprisingly resilient to the noise and busyness of our classroom. They are easy to keep clean, feed and handle and they can't hurt the children at all. Parents are fascinated too. I've kept these insects before and had wonderful success with breeding too which gives the children a perfect experience in life cycles. (The moulting is amazing to watch) My minibeast widlife insects arrived in great condition and the feedback was very insightful and helpful when one of them died unexpectedly after a few weeks. Be especially aware of any pest spraying at the property in the last six months and don't forget not to use fly spray around them!
